Ms. Katherine Leigh Lackey is a lawyer practicing commercial litigation, appellate, energy and 7 other areas of law. Katherine received a B.A. degree from Baylor University in 1997, and has been licensed for 21 years. Katherine practices at Cantey Hanger LLP in Fort Worth, TX.

What to bring to your first meeting
Bring any documents you already have — police reports, medical records, filed pleadings, correspondence from an insurer, a copy of the contract at issue. If you're not sure, err on the side of bringing everything; Katherine will tell you what matters and what doesn't.
Questions to ask a appellate attorney in Fort Worth, Texas
A short list to run through before you commit: How many appellate matters have you handled in the last year? What's your fee structure? Who else in the office will work on this? What's your realistic estimate of timeline and range of outcomes? How do I reach you between meetings?
